To provide an air-conditioning system for a building utilizing geothermy for obtaining an efficient air-conditioning and heating effect in the building by maintaining the desired humidity of air cooled and heated using geothermy and flowing in the building.
This air-conditioning system is provided with a heat storage chamber 7 formed under the floor of the building having an outside air passage around; a heat exchange pipe 16 buried underground so that the opening end communicates with the inside of the heat storage chamber; air passages formed under the floor and in the wall and ceiling of the building and communicating with the heat storage chamber; and a dehumidifier for dehumidifying air supplied into the air passages. Air cooled or warmed by geothermy by the heat exchange pipe and dehumidified by the dehumidifier is allowed to flow in the air passages to regulate room temperature in the building. A filter for imparting antibacterial action or the like to air flowing in the air passages 4a-4c is disposed at or near the dehumidifier.
